Troubleshoot Your Xbox 360 Quick Charge Kit

If you encounter problems with your Xbox 360 Quick Charge Kit, try the possible solutions provided below.

Charge Light Doesn't Glow

Make sure the kit's Xbox 360 Rechargeable Battery Pack is completely locked in to the charger battery compartment. If the battery pack is completely locked in to the compartment and the light does not glow green or red, the battery pack or charger may be defective.

Important

Damaged battery packs will not charge and could harm your controller. Battery packs that have been crushed, immersed in liquids, or exposed to intense heat may be damaged beyond use and should be disposed of in accordance with local laws.

Battery Pack Charges Slowly

Very depleted rechargeable battery packs can take longer to charge.

Battery Pack Charge Depletes Quickly

The amount of play time will decrease as the battery pack ages or after many recharge cycles. The battery pack should be replaced when play time becomes unacceptably short or when it can no longer be charged.
